Article: James Gandolfini reflective as U.S. television series "The Sopranos" nears end

DAVID BAUDER, AP Television Writer
AP Worldstream
01-14-2006
Dateline: PASADENA, California
Tony Soprano can be tough on James Gandolfini, too.

"It's a dark, dark world and you're in it a lot," the star of the U.S. television hit series "The Sopranos" said of his career-defining character. "However, if you're in a dark world, I can't think of any other to be in. There are a lot of pluses. It just takes a heavy toll sometimes."
